It used to be a regular feature of this competition.bixieupnorth wrote:capital one cup is during the week before league starts
that's never happened before has it?
The first leg used to be on the Saturday before the league games started and the second leg on the Tuesday or Wednesday before.
With our evening kick offs on a Saturday one hot August League Cup game the whole of Cardiff camped out in Torquay from about 8 in the morning and needless to say few were capable of standing by kick off time let alone watch a football game. We won and they smashed up Plainmoor and St Marychurch as they left (think someone suggested they smashed up Hele as well but there was nothing obvious!
